Six weeks after AI bets nearly wrecked his hedge fund, Leopold Aschenbrenner is putting money into the same companies again. His hedge fund, Situational Awareness, bought call options on AMD, Bloom Energy, CoreWeave, SK Hynix and SanDisk, CNBC reported, citing sources. The trades ran from late last week into this week.
The former OpenAI researcher became famous for a 2024 essay arguing that AI could reach human-level intelligence by 2027. He built an investment business around that belief, backing companies supplying the computing capacity and electricity AI needs.
July exposed how dangerous that bet had become. Borrowed money magnified falling share prices, triggering demands for cash the fund could not meet. **** ets shrank from a peak above $45 billion to roughly $10 billion, according to CNBC.
Ken Griffin's Citadel bought distressed holdings at a discount. Situational Awareness kept private investments, including Anthropic. The SEC later subpoenaed Wall Street banks over their dealings with the fund. The reported inquiry carried no allegation of wrongdoing.
His return uses call options: contracts that let buyers purchase shares at a fixed price before a deadline. When paid for upfront without borrowing, their losses are capped at the purchase cost. That entire amount can still disappear if the options expire worthless.
